Maine Loco come up short of expectations, lose to Dirt € Warriors in 143.20-95.44 romp

There's no sugarcoating it, Maine Loco underdelivered, at least compared to projections, as Dirt € Warriors cruised to a 143.20-95.44 win. Dirt € Warriors got out to an 8.30-point lead on Thursday behind Antonio Gibson and never gave it up. T.J. Hockenson (16.6 points) and Najee Harris (16.6) led the way for Maine Loco in the loss. Dirt € Warriors (1-1) will look to notch another win against GainesVILLAINS, while Maine Loco (0-2) will try to earn their first win against G.O.A.T.

Matchup Player of the Week

Going up against the Titans in Week 2, Lockett caught 8 passes for 178 yards and a touchdown. In doing so, he put up 27.8 points and nearly doubled his scoring projection, the highest percent increase of any player on Dirt € Warriors this week. In Week 3, Lockett and the Seahawks will square off against the Vikings.
